PHOTOSENSITIZATION OF MELANINS: A COMPARATIVE STUDY
Authors:T Sarna    I A Menon  Roger C  Sealy
Affiliation:National Biomedical ESR Center, Department of Radiology, Medical College of Wisconsin, Milwaukee, WI 53226, USA;Clinical Science Division, Medical Sciences Building, University of Toronto, Toronto, Canada
Abstract:Abstract— Measurements of photosensitized free-radical production and oxygen consumption have been made in several melanin systems. The melanins studied were cysteinyldopa melanin (a model for pheomelanin), natural pheomelanins extracted from red hair and from red chicken feathers, and eumelanin extracted from bovine eyes. Rose Bengal was used as photosensitizer. A significant enhancement in the rates of free radical production and oxygen consumption was found in all systems when sensitizer was present. The largest effects were found with cysteinyldopa melanin and effects on pheomelanins were shown to be greater (by factors of4–6) than on eumelanins.
